Bridges Prep boys basketball kept its hot streak going with a 54-24 home rout of crosstown rival Holy Trinity on Monday for the Bucs’ seventh straight victory.


Desmond Locke continued his red-hot start with 13 points, 10 rebounds, and four steals, and Damien Bee added 10 points, seven boards, eight assists, and five steals in another outstanding all-around performance to lead the Bucs.
Matthew Torres knocked down a trio of 3-pointers for Bridges, while Jeremiah Ponder added seven points, and Davion Washington had six points and seven boards.
Bridges (8-2) has won seven straight games heading into its Region 6-1A opener at home against Bethune-Bowman on Tuesday. Holy Trinity (3-5) has dropped three straight and travels to Charleston Collegiate on Thursday.
